Why Hire Specialist Security Guards for Pharmaceutical Facilities?

Pharmaceutical facilities store controlled substances, hazardous materials, and sensitive research data, making them subject to some of the most stringent regulatory requirements of any industry. Professional security guards play a vital role in helping your organisation meet these obligations while preventing theft, contamination, and unauthorised access. Trained pharmaceutical security personnel understand the specific protocols and compliance standards that apply to your environment, providing far more targeted protection than a standard security provider could offer. At Nationwide Services, our officers deliver a comprehensive range of security services tailored to the pharmaceutical sector, including perimeter access control to manage who enters and exits your site, non-entry observation to monitor external areas without disrupting operations, production area monitoring to maintain safety and compliance on the manufacturing floor, inspector access facilitation to ensure smooth and controlled third-party visits, and full area securing at the close of each working day. For pharmaceutical businesses across Padiham, Lancashire, professional security guarding is not simply a precaution; it is an essential component of responsible and compliant facility management.
